The human spine compromises a series of small bones called ‘vertebrae’, along with muscles and ligaments. The spine has a natural curve which extends from the front to the back but it shouldn’t curve towards the side too much. The side bend in the spine is known as scoliosis and takes on either a ‘S’ (double curve) or long ‘C’(single curve).
There are plentiful varied reasons of spinal curves. A number of babies are natural with spinal imperfections while some have nerve or muscle disorders.In common cases, the real reason of scoliosis is not identified. This type of scoliosis is termed as “idiopathic scoliosis” and has no recognized cause. There is not any eminent cure as well. It shows if you have scoliosis, nobody can do anything to prevent it. Scoliosis usually begins in the ages of 8 and 10. Scoliosis that is cruel enough to need cure is mainly frequent in girls.
Scoliosis seldom shows any signs or symptoms in small children till the spinal curve appears fully developed in form. There are many noticeable signs which can be taken note of by parents and doctors and orthopedists, scoliosis, orthopedic surgeons and nurses. The signs are one shoulder or hip that looks elevated than the other. The patient’s waistline is plane on one side, or the ribs may appear uppers on one side when the patient twists frontward at the waist. In adults, this may appear in the form of back pain and breathing difficulty.

Adults with modest or harsh scoliosis can have increasingly worsened curves with severe back pain and in the nastiest cases trouble breathing. Treatment following the curve has previously become critical in maturity and is fewer successful than treatment in childhood or teenage years. Easygoing cases of scoliosis frequently do not require treatment. Doctors have to test the curve of patient’s spine every 4 to 6 months repeatedly. In serious situations, or if bracing doesn’t help out, then it is obvious to have surgery.
Some curvatures don’t respond to bracing therapy, if you possess a curve such as this, then you will require surgery. However Scoliosis surgery procedures have various possible implications which may consist of heavy blood loss, paraplegia and infection in the hip joints, degenerated tissues and even death.
The main scoliosis surgery complications include: Allergic reactions, Bleeding, Postoperative pain, Nerve damage, Pseudoarthrosis, Disc degeneration, Low back pain.
Scoliosis treatment without surgery that is exercise or braces or other techniques are also possible but it will truly depend on the position, and also the scale (cruelty) of the curve in the spine.
The physical therapy specialists can better estimate your latest position, muscle force, elasticity and suggests you a home based exercise plan which is intended particularly for you or your patient.
